Output 3ab8db725f41eee8e82273fbffbfca12cda805fa7414cc5b3d9e5cbc4967c4b4:0

value
411530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17cd7faab7e38cfa1cb4d1340e9b3929a43336ae OP_EQUAL
address
33rseFncWB8WfpnyuuMXacTDL4ekiUA9kb
transaction
3ab8db725f41eee8e82273fbffbfca12cda805fa7414cc5b3d9e5cbc4967c4b4
confirmations
562577
spent
true